Output d3bd13e49e69d60ba1804578ceceee12d26689878a9e6a2a7ee0238e70fc49ce:1

value
25640000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cf578cb66e5d012e4a611f1b2df24e4e42c26970 OP_EQUAL
address
3LbLgJugBs1bnwB8xNohuous9ob5J4sEyv
transaction
d3bd13e49e69d60ba1804578ceceee12d26689878a9e6a2a7ee0238e70fc49ce
spent
true